The Persian New Year is widely celebrated in regions which were once part of the Persian Empire. Variously known as Novruz Nowrouz Nooruz Navruz Nauroz or Nevruz this historic rite is observed on 21 March in many countries along the Silk Roads including Afghanistan Azerbaijan India Iran Iraq Kyrgyzstan Kazakhstan Pakistan Tajikistan Turkey Turkmenistan. Nowruz Novruz Navruz Nooruz Nevruz Nauryz which means new day marks the first day of spring and is celebrated on the day of the astronomical vernal equinox which usually occurs on 21 March.

Nowruz promotes values of peace and solidarity between generations and within families the United Nations says. Now meaning New and Ruz meaning Day which when combined together means New Day. Nowruz also spelled Nōrūz Nō Rūz or Nō-Rūz festival celebrating the new year on the Persian calendar usually beginning on March 21 on the Gregorian calendar.
